Product details
Written by:Guest
Customers who bought this product also purchased...
- Cleveland Guardians Snapback 25G012
- #ID:903187 $0.00$10.00
- Cleveland Guardians Snapback 25G014
- #ID:903207 $0.00$10.00
- Cleveland Guardians Snapback 25G011
- #ID:903217 $0.00$10.00
- Cleveland Guardians Snapback 25G015
- #ID:903250 $0.00$10.00
- Cleveland Guardians Snapback 25G004
- #ID:903288 $0.00$10.00
- Cleveland Guardians Snapback 25G009
- #ID:903324 $0.00$10.00
- Cleveland Guardians Snapback Cap 25906
- #ID:910191 $0.00$10.00
- Cleveland Guardians Snapback Cap 25K Y803
- #ID:915113 $0.00$10.00
- Cleveland Guardians Snapback Cap 25K P096
- #ID:915123 $0.00$10.00
- Cleveland Guardians Snapback Cap 25K W065
- #ID:915135 $0.00$10.00











































































































































































